One key element in supporting circulation is physical activity. Regular exercise not only strengthens the heart but also helps to improve blood flow throughout the body. Activities such as walking, swimming, cycling, or yoga are excellent for stimulating circulation. Engaging in at least 30 minutes of moderate exercise several times a week can significantly improve vascular health. Additionally, incorporating activities that promote flexibility and balance can enhance blood flow and overall circulation.
Nutrition also plays a pivotal role in improving circulation and metabolism. Diets rich in fruits, vegetables, whole grains, and healthy fats can boost heart health. Foods high in antioxidants, such as berries, spinach, and nuts, help combat oxidative stress, which can damage blood vessels. Omega-3 fatty acids, commonly found in fish like salmon and seeds like flaxseed, are known to support healthy blood flow and reduce inflammation. Spices such as ginger and garlic are also beneficial, as they have properties that help dilate blood vessels and improve circulation.
Hydration is another critical aspect of maintaining proper circulation. Water is vital for transporting nutrients and oxygen throughout the body. Insufficient hydration can lead to thicker blood, making it more difficult for the heart to pump effectively. Aiming for eight glasses of water a day, or more depending on individual activity levels and climate, can help ensure that your circulatory system functions optimally. Incorporating herbal teas or water-rich fruits and vegetables into your diet can also contribute to hydration.
Furthermore, stress management is essential for supporting both circulation and metabolism. Chronic stress can lead to elevated cortisol levels, which may negatively impact heart health and metabolic function. Practices such as meditation, deep-breathing exercises, or mindfulness can help reduce stress and promote relaxation. Engaging in activities that bring joy and fulfillment, such as hobbies, socializing, or spending time in nature, can also lower stress levels and contribute to overall well-being.
Sleep is another significant factor in improving circulation and metabolism. Quality sleep allows the body to repair and rejuvenate, impacting hormones that regulate appetite and energy. Aim for 7 to 9 hours of restful sleep each night. Creating a calming bedtime routine, avoiding electronic devices before sleep, and maintaining a comfortable sleep environment can enhance sleep quality.
